The Truth About Buying Glassdoor Reviews in Bulk

The allure of boosting your company's Glassdoor profile with numerous, favorable reviews is logical, but obtaining them in bulk is a risky practice. Basically, it’s a infraction of Glassdoor's terms of service and likely to backfire. These platforms have complex algorithms created to detect artificial reviews, leading to penalties ranging from review removal to severe profile suspension. Furthermore, even though you manage to circumvent immediate detection, the lack of authenticity will become obvious to potential employees, undermining your employer brand and ultimately discouraging top talent from working for your company. Rather than resorting to such dishonest tactic, focus on authentic employee engagement and building a positive work atmosphere that naturally promotes honest and helpful feedback.
